Transaction 73f64c748178f846038f0e5e8bb3d737ea24a2fc889f7ee6be68446f53b981bd
1 Input
2 Outputs
- 73f64c748178f846038f0e5e8bb3d737ea24a2fc889f7ee6be68446f53b981bd:0
- 73f64c748178f846038f0e5e8bb3d737ea24a2fc889f7ee6be68446f53b981bd:1
value 72620
address 36nk3WE26nbGsaYzTaUdciuspaxbPVCijU
value 3401010
address 18zQbo4wTEpjULdoFCbCLkEZ6QM27Zmyhy